1. The Tower of London, England
A Fortress of Death and Hauntings
The Tower of London has witnessed over 900 years of history, filled with executions, imprisonment, and bloody betrayals. This medieval fortress is infamous for its ghostly residents, including:
- Anne Boleyn – The beheaded wife of King Henry VIII, often seen wandering the tower holding her severed head.
- The Princes in the Tower – The young princes, Edward V and Richard, were imprisoned and mysteriously vanished. Their spirits are said to haunt the Bloody Tower.
- The White Lady – Many visitors report an eerie perfume scent and a cold presence in the White Tower.
Paranormal Encounters
Guards have reported ghostly apparitions, sudden temperature drops, and chilling screams echoing through the halls at night.
2. The Stanley Hotel, USA
Inspiration for The Shining
Nestled in Estes Park, Colorado, the Stanley Hotel is best known as the inspiration for Stephen King’s horror novel The Shining. Guests and staff report bizarre encounters, including:
- Piano playing by itself in the music room, attributed to the ghost of Flora Stanley.
- Laughter of ghost children running in the halls.
- Room 217 – A hotspot for paranormal activity where King himself had a haunting experience.
Spooky Stay
The hotel embraces its haunted reputation by offering ghost tours and a Shining-themed experience for thrill-seekers.
3. Bhangarh Fort, India
The Most Haunted Place in India
The ruined Bhangarh Fort in Rajasthan is so eerie that entry is forbidden after sunset by government order. According to legend:
- A cursed wizard doomed the town after falling in love with a local princess.
- The entire population mysteriously vanished overnight.
- Locals claim strange voices, shadows, and eerie screams can be heard at night.
Warnings for Visitors
Those who dare to visit after dark often experience strange visions, disembodied whispers, and an overwhelming feeling of dread.
4. The Catacombs of Paris, France
The City of the Dead
Beneath the romantic city of Paris lies a horrifying underground world—the Catacombs. This vast network of tunnels holds the remains of over six million people, creating a chilling atmosphere.
- Visitors report ghostly whispers and moving shadows in the dark tunnels.
- Some explorers have gone missing, never to be found again.
- A chilling video discovered in the 1990s shows a man lost in the Catacombs, panicking before vanishing.
A Haunting Experience
The official tour covers a small section, but urban explorers who enter illegally often report disturbing encounters and an unshakable feeling of being watched.
5. Poveglia Island, Italy
A Plague Island of Death
This forbidden island near Venice has a dark history of being a quarantine zone for plague victims and later, an insane asylum.
- Patients reported seeing shadows and hearing screams.
- A mad doctor who performed experiments on patients allegedly jumped to his death, but was engulfed by a mysterious mist.
- Fishermen refuse to sail near the island, fearing ghostly apparitions rising from the waters.
Entry is Illegal
Poveglia remains off-limits, but ghost hunters claim it’s one of the scariest places in the world.
